Allspring Global Investments Holdings LLC acquired a new position in Rigetti Computing, Inc. (NASDAQ:RGTI - Free Report) during the 1st qu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The firm acquired 22,733 shares of the company's stock, valued at approximately $178,000.
Several other hedge funds and other institutional investors have also modified their holdings of RGTI. Bank of New York Mellon Corp lifted its position in Rigetti Computing by 27.4% in the fourth quarter. Bank of New York Mellon Corp now owns 446,692 shares of the company's stock worth $6,817,000 after purchasing an additional 96,099 shares during the period. US Bancorp DE bought a new position in shares of Rigetti Computing during the fourth quarter valued at $74,000. Jones Financial Companies Lllp bought a new position in shares of Rigetti Computing during the fourth quarter valued at $50,000. Steward Partners Investment Advisory LLC bought a new position in shares of Rigetti Computing during the fourth quarter valued at $83,000. Finally, Charles Schwab Investment Management Inc. lifted its holdings in shares of Rigetti Computing by 15.6% during the fourth quarter. Charles Schwab Investment Management Inc. now owns 1,329,590 shares of the company's stock valued at $20,290,000 after acquiring an additional 179,656 shares during the period. Institutional investors and hedge funds own 35.38% of the company's stock.
Analysts Set New Price Targets
A number of research analysts have issued reports on RGTI shares. Benchmark reissued a "buy" rating and set a $14.00 price objective on shares of Rigetti Computing in a report on Thursday, May 15th. Cantor Fitzgerald assumed coverage on Rigetti Computing in a report on Wednesday, July 2nd. They issued an "overweight" rating and a $15.00 price target for the company. Finally, Needham & Company LLC lowered their price objective on Rigetti Computing from $17.00 to $15.00 and set a "buy" rating for the company in a research report on Wednesday, May 14th. Six analysts have rated the stock with a buy rating, Based on data from MarketBeat.com, Rigetti Computing presently has a consensus rating of "Buy" and an average price target of $14.20.

Rigetti Computing Trading Down 6.5%
Rigetti Computing stock opened at $12.18 on Friday. The company has a market capitalization of $3.54 billion, a PE ratio of -17.40 and a beta of 1.43. Rigetti Computing, Inc. has a 12 month low of $0.66 and a 12 month high of $21.42. The stock has a 50-day moving average price of $11.90 and a two-hundred day moving average price of $11.10.

Rigetti Computing, Inc, through its subsidiaries, builds quantum computers and the superconducting quantum processors. The company offers cloud in a form of quantum processing unit, such as 9-qubit chip and Ankaa-2 system under the Novera brand name; and sells access to its quantum computers through quantum computing as a service.
